Role Summary

Design high-speed silicon photonic integrated circuits (PICs) from concept through tapeout and silicon validation for production-bound systems. Work within an R&D/engineering team that co-designs photonics, electronics, and packaging for high-bandwidth optical transceivers.

Experience Level

Suitable for PhD graduates and early-career engineers (~0–5 years experience). Role expects hands-on PIC design and tapeout experience rather than purely simulation work.

Responsibilities

Deliver PIC designs, support tapeout and silicon bring-up, and collaborate across disciplines to meet system targets.

  • Design and optimize silicon photonic devices and circuits: high-speed modulators, photodetectors/receivers, and passive components (couplers, filters, routing).
  • Perform multi-domain simulations (electromagnetic, circuit, thermal) to meet bandwidth, loss, and efficiency targets (e.g., 200G/lane+).
  • Implement PIC layouts (GDS) using foundry PDKs and support tapeout flows and DRC/LVS checks.
  • Co-design with electronics and packaging teams to address RF effects, parasitics, signal integrity, and thermal constraints for CPO/NPO systems.
  • Support silicon bring-up and characterization, correlate measurements with simulation, and drive iterative design improvements.
  • Contribute to design libraries, device modeling, and methodology development.

Requirements

Must-have technical skills and relevant hands-on experience. Nice-to-have items listed separately.

  • Experience designing and simulating silicon photonic devices or PICs (device-level and circuit-level).
  • Strong understanding of guided-wave optics and photonic device physics.
  • Familiarity with simulation tools such as Lumerical, COMSOL, or equivalents.
  • Exposure to PIC layout and tapeout flows, including working with foundry PDKs and performing DRC/LVS.
  • Basic systems awareness of optical communication links and RF effects impacting transceivers.

Nice to have:

  • Experience with very high-speed devices (>100 GHz) or related measurement techniques.
  • Exposure to CPO/NPO architectures or optical transceiver system integration.
  • Familiarity with SiPh + III-V integration approaches.
  • Experience with inverse design / adjoint methods (e.g., Meep).
